Bobo-dioulasso: Talent FC wins 300,000 CFA francs at the CNAVC Super Cup after their 2-0 victory. Launched on January 25, 2026, the grand final of the Super Cup of the National Coordination of Citizen Watch Associations (CNAVC), Houet section, was played on Saturday, February 28, 2026, in Bobo-Dioulasso. According to Burkina Information Agency, this sporting competition aimed to promote social cohesion and living together through football, by mobilizing young people around the ideals of peace, solidarity, and civic responsibility. Thirty-two teams started the match, with Talent FC in red and Team FDR in blue battling it out in the final. At the end of regulation time, Talent FC emerged victorious with a score of two goals to zero, thus claiming the trophy for this inaugural CNAVC Houet Super Cup. Beyond the sporting aspect, the CNAVC Super Cup, themed "Sport in the Service of Cohesion, Patriotism, and Peace," aims to be a platform for expressing and disseminating the ideals of the progressive popular revolu tion underway in Burkina Faso. "We are very pleased to have organized this competition. The message has been received by young people. We thank all those who supported us," declared El Hadj Zakaria Sore, president of the CNAVC Houet branch. Present at the ceremony, the event's director, Commander Karim Souabou, praised the success of this first edition and congratulated the organizers on their initiative. Several administrative and military authorities, including the commander of the Second Military Region, Lieutenant-Colonel Lassane Porgo, as well as figures from the private sector and a large crowd from Bobo-Dioulasso, also graced the final with their presence. Talent FC, the winner of the tournament, took home prizes, a ball, a set of jerseys, 300,000 CFA francs, and the trophy. Team FDR, the runner-up, received the same prizes and sports kits, along with 200,000 CFA francs. The organizing committee also presented certificates of appreciation to the various partners and individuals for their support of t his inaugural event. Through this Super Cup, the CNAVC Houet intends to establish sport permanently as a powerful lever for bringing communities together, raising civic awareness, and consolidating social peace in the province of Houet.
